2010-12-08 4 views

Répondre

1

Ce que vous avez est très bien. Si vous voulez également valider le modèle associé, vous pouvez:

class Utensil < ActiveRecord::Base 
    belongs_to :manufacturer 

    validates_associated :manufacturer 
    validates_presence_of :manufacturer_id 
end 

Espérons que cela aide!

+0

ces méthodes sont obsolètes dans ror 3, ne sont-ils pas? – sandrew

+0

@GearHead - pas que je sache. Il n'y a aucune mention de dépréciation dans les guides API Docs ou Rails. – Brian

+0

désolé, vous avez raison. ces méthodes seront dépréciées en 3.1 et supprimées en 3.2 :) – sandrew